Our goal at EIT Food North-East is to redesign the way we produce, deliver, consume and recycle our food.

What we do

EIT Food Co-Location Centre North-East was established in Warsaw in 2017. Together with our partners from Denmark, Finland, Sweden, Lithuania, Hungary and Poland we work towards making the food system more resource-efficient, secure, transparent and trusted.
Our goal is to boost the skills and entrepreneurial spirit in agri-food sector in order to deliver a healthier lifestyle for all European citizens.

CLC North-East coordinates implementation of RIS activities in Central and Eastern Europe.
